📖 À propos Dawud
Dawud est la forme coranique classique de David, signifiant "bien-aimé." Honoré comme prophète-roi ayant reçu les Psaumes et vaincu Goliath, ce prénom est vénéré dans tout le monde musulman, de l'Afrique du Nord à l'Indonésie.

⭐ Personnes Célèbres
- Dawud al-Zahiri — Medieval Islamic scholar and theologian who founded the Zahiri school of Islamic jurisprudence, advocating strict literal interpretation of the Quran and Hadith
- Dawud Wharnsby — Canadian Muslim singer-songwriter and poet known internationally for his nasheed music promoting peace, spirituality, and environmental consciousness
- Dawud Salahuddin — American-born figure who became notable for his conversion to Islam and subsequent involvement in Cold War-era geopolitics
- Dawood Ibrahim — Indian crime figure and one of the most wanted men in the world, whose name (variant spelling) became synonymous with organized crime in South Asia
